Anne-Lise Polchlopek
French young mezzo-soprano Anne-Lise Polchlopek is part of the Lyon National Opera House Studio, and currently trains with José van Dam and Sophie Koch at Queen Elisabeth Music Chapel.
She took part in various relevant master-classes led by: Ludovic Tézier, Stéphane Degout, Felicity Lott, Susan Manoff, William Christie, among others.
Laureate of the Parisian Association New Talents (2019), of the Royaumont Foundation (2020/2021/2022), and of Nadia and Lili Boulanger International Competition with Elenora Pertz (piano), she will be involved in two CD recordings this season (Éditions Hortus and B Records).
Elenora Pertz
The Italian-American Pianist Elenora Pertz specializes in collaborating with singers, both on and off the stage. This season she is a participant of the prestigious Académie Orsay-Royaumont, which will culminate in a tour of song recitals throughout Europe in the 2022-23 season. An avid recitalist, she has appeared on stages throughout Europe and America at venues such as Deutsche Oper Berlin.
Elenora Pertz is a prize winner of numerous Lied competitions such as Concours international de chant-piano Nadia et Lili Boulanger (2021), Les Saisons de la Voix (2020) and was a finalist of Das Lied (2019). Additionally, she is a regular guest at all three Berlin Opera houses, and in the beginning of 2022 will make her debut at the Berliner Staatsoper in a premiere of Janáček’s Več Makropulos under the musical direction of Sir Simon Rattle.
